Definition
- Indefinite Pronoun:
- Each and all / Everyone / All without exception: Refers to every individual within a defined group, emphasizing collective and unanimous action or state. It is used to indicate that something applies to every single person mentioned or implied.
Usage Examples
- Indefinite Pronoun:
- Cả công ty ai nấy đều thương tiếc anh ta. (The whole company, each and all, regretted his death.)
- Ai nấy đều phấn khởi. (Everyone was enthusiastic.)
- Khi nghe tin ấy, ai nấy đều sửng sốt. (When they heard that news, one and all were astonished.)
Advanced Usage
- The phrase is often used to start a sentence or clause to emphasize the universality of a feeling or action among a group.
- Ai nấy, từ trẻ đến già, đều tụ tập ở sân. (Everyone, from young to old, gathered in the yard.)
Variants and Related Words
Mọi người (indefinite pronoun): everyone, everybody. This is a more common and neutral synonym.
- Mọi người đều đồng ý. (Everyone agreed.)
Tất cả (indefinite pronoun): all. Can refer to people or things.
- Tất cả chúng tôi đều sẵn sàng. (All of us are ready.)

Related Idioms
Ai nấy đều một lòng: Everyone is of one mind/united in purpose.
- Trong hoạn nạn, ai nấy đều một lòng. (In adversity, everyone was united.)
Ai nấy đều tiu nghỉu: Everyone is dejected/dispirited.
- Sau thất bại, ai nấy đều tiu nghỉu. (After the defeat, everyone was dispirited.)
